WebOnce the domestic oil is ignited, hot exhaust gases pass through a heat exchanger, usually a copper coil, transferring energy to the water circulating through it. This heats up the water which is then distributed throughout the house via radiators, warming up the rooms. The hot water can also be used in your taps and showers.
